Diamonds of Orient
Rare oriental percussion Construction Kits & Single Instrument loops - Real percussive diamonds played by native top musicians Natik & Xeyam, Nistemann Sansar, Celal Sansar, Emrah Sansar, Oezkan & Efkan Durmaz !!!
A huge variety of oriental and ethnic percussion styles in 3/4, 5/8, 6/8, 7/8, 9/8, 10/8, 12/8 measure. Userfriendly cut, combinable with each other and ready to use also in a 4/4 track!
This acoustic journey takes you from the Caucasus to Balkan, with sonic stopovers in Azerbaijan, Turkey, Persia, Chechenia, Turkmenistan, Bulgaria, Greece, Iraq and Macedonia!
Instruments:
Nagara & Gosha-Nagara played by the azerbaijani top musicans Natik and Xeyam Hi- & Bass Darbuka by Nistemann Sansar. Davul & Bendir by Celal Sansar Bongo, Tef, Shaker, Tumba, Zil, middleanatolian Spoons by Oezkan Durmaz Hollo & Udu by Emrah Sansar
Efkan Durmaz recorded a big variety of rare oriental grooves in high quality audio. To keep the natural warmth of the original sound, Neumann U87 microphones where used for the whole production.
"My special thanks making this library possible goes to Funda Durmaz, Oezkan Durmaz, Ugur Eskimez, Nistemann Sansar, Celal Sansar, Natik & Xeyam ... and all users of Diamonds of Orient!" Efkan Durmaz
